### Runbook: Report export timezone mismatches (Glimmerfield)

If a customer reports that exported totals differ from the dashboard, check whether their report schedule predates the March cutover — older schedules still render in server-local time rather than the account timezone. Re-saving the schedule fixes it. Before escalating, confirm the export worker is running with the expected timezone settings shown below.

config for kadup-kajog:
[raldor]
host = raldor.tolvaqworks.internal
user = raldor_svc
database = raldor_prod

# Heads up, support folks: this is the little script that sweeps the
# Pinwheel app for translation strings and ships them off to Lingotray,
# our internal localization hub. If a customer reports a missing or
# garbled string, you can rerun this to force a fresh extraction pass —
# it's safe and idempotent, promise. The client setup below just needs
# network access and one credential. The key it authenticates with is
# right below this comment.

API key for yahig-tadup: kto7_ubizbYm

## Ownership

The large-file diff viewer (`bigdiff/`) renders diffs for files over 10 MB using chunked streaming instead of loading both versions into memory. It has its own rendering pipeline, separate from the standard viewer — do not merge the two without an approved design doc. Performance regressions here block release, so changes require a benchmark run attached to the PR. New team members: read `bigdiff/ARCHITECTURE.md` before touching anything. All review requests and escalations go to the owner named below.

named custodian: Brivan Eliath Quenox Frador

Handover note: StormRelay fan-out

Welcome aboard — I'm handing StormRelay, our weather-alert fan-out service, over to Priya-of-the-platform-team's group. It consumes alerts from the Cindermere feed and fans them out to regional topics with per-severity throttling. The tricky part is the dedupe window; too short and subscribers get duplicate tornado alerts, too long and updates get swallowed. Please read the runbook before changing anything. The current production values are shown below.

deployment values, kajep-kageg:
[praix]
host = praix.paliqcorp.corp
user = praix_svc
database = praix_prod